Meet Sayches’ Fish: The New Symbol of Digital Privacy

Sayches’ mascot aspires to build brand awareness and symbolise human rights to Internet privacy

The British IT company Sayches has unveiled its official brand mascot in all its social media channels. Sayches’ fish, a hybrid of an elephant and a fish, is a private creature that defends users’ rights to privacy, anonymity, and transparency.

“It is easy to catch a fish, but it is difficult to hunt an elephant. So, we created a hybrid animal by giving the strength of the elephant to the weaker organism. This way, Sayches will be able to fight threats that it aspires to nullify”, states the company, referring to the threat of the ever-growing accessibility to user data in the online world.

Sayches’ fish, as it is being called for now, will soon have its name decided by the online community. Much like some iconic brand characters, such as Tux (Linux), Octocat (GitHub) and Dax (DuckDuckGo), Sayches’ mascot aims to increase user engagement and brand exposure online by providing a positive perception of the company’s social conscience. Created to symbolise the digital privacy offered by the company’s services, the Elephant-Fish hybrid will essentially help build brand loyalty and awareness amongst Sayches’ users.

One notable example of the importance of brand loyalty and customer awareness in the industry is from Apple Inc. The American technology company, famous for its high-quality products and innovative marketing strategies, has improved its retention and brand loyalty by creating an emotional connection with its consumers, paying close attention to details not only in products and services, but also in customer experience.

In this respect, Sayches’ fish presents itself as one of the brand pillars, as it offers the online community a friendly and familiar face to which users will have a chance to connect with. In turn, this relationship will build positive brand loyalty and establish Sayches and its mascot as one of the newest symbols of Internet privacy.

“As another revenue stream, our Elephant-Fish mascot will be used to create unique merchandising products. Investment will be made in the company to create a unique, elegant and attractive brand, as we want to make Sayches a symbol of digital privacy”, describes the start-up. Ahead of the social media platform launch, the company has recently released Sayches Sticker Packs, containing illustrations of the Elephant-Fish mascot, available for Telegram and iMessage users.

About Sayches

Sayches is a British IT company based in London, UK. On a mission to make the Internet a better place, the start-up develops new products and services with the fundamental principle to uphold human rights to privacy, anonymity, and transparency without any compromises.
